vue.js使用什么版本

fiy 其他 10

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ue.js目前最新的版本是3.0.5。不过,在选择使用哪个版本的Vue.js时,应该根据自己的项目需求和团队的技术状况来进行判断。

    1. Vue 2.x:Vue.js的2.x版本是目前广泛使用的稳定版本,有大量的社区支持和生态系统。Vue 2.x使用的是旧的Vue运行时架构,并且与Vue 3.x的一些新特性不兼容。如果你的项目目前正在使用Vue 2.x,并且没有特别需要升级到Vue 3.x的原因,那么继续使用2.x版本是一个安全可靠的选择。

    2. Vue 3.x:Vue.js的3.x版本在性能和体验上有显著的改进,并且引入了一些新特性和优化。Vue 3.x使用的是新的Vue运行时架构,并且在一些核心概念和API上有了不同的实现。如果你的项目是一个较新的项目,并且你对Vue.js的新特性和改进非常感兴趣,那么可以考虑使用Vue 3.x。

    总结来说,如果你的项目已经在使用Vue 2.x,并且没有特殊需求的话,继续使用2.x版本是一个稳妥的选择;如果你正在开始一个新的项目,或者对Vue 3.x的新特性有需求,可以考虑使用3.x版本。不过,无论选择哪个版本,都需要充分评估团队的技术状况,并确保在升级版本时有足够的时间和资源来处理潜在的兼容性问题。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    目前,最新版本的Vue.js是Vue 3。但是,根据使用情况和项目需求,你也可以选择使用已发布的其他版本。

    下面是一些常见的Vue.js版本:

    1. Vue 1:这是Vue.js的第一个版本,它在2014年2月发布。然而,目前已经不推荐使用Vue 1,因为Vue团队不再维护它。

    2. Vue 2:Vue 2是Vue.js的第二个主要版本,于2016年10月发布。它是目前广泛应用的版本,拥有庞大的生态系统和活跃的开发社区。

    3. Vue 3:Vue 3是最新的Vue.js版本,于2020年9月发布。它带来了许多重大改进和新特性,如更好的性能、更好的类型支持、Composition API等。但与Vue 2不兼容,所以迁移现有项目可能需要一些工作。

    无论你选择哪个版本,都可以借助Vue CLI(一个脚手架工具)来创建和管理Vue.js项目。Vue CLI可用于创建项目模板、自动化构建和开发,以及方便的部署。

    此外,还有Vue.js的一些其他扩展版本和衍生产品,如Vue Router(用于构建单页面应用程序的官方路由器)和Vuex(用于集中管理Vue.js应用程序状态的官方状态管理库)。这些工具可以与Vue.js一起使用,以满足更复杂的应用程序需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ue.js是一款开源的JavaScript框架,用于构建用户界面。根据目前的情况,Vue.js有两个主要的版本:Vue 2.x和Vue 3.x。接下来,我将详细介绍这两个版本的特点和使用方法。

    Vue 2.x版本

    Vue 2.x是目前使用最广泛的版本,也是许多项目中的首选。以下是Vue 2.x版本的一些特点和使用方法:

    特点:

    1. 模板语法:Vue 2.x使用了基于HTML的模板语法,可以方便地声明和渲染DOM。

    2. 组件化开发:Vue 2.x支持组件化开发,可以将页面划分为多个独立组件,提高代码的可读性和复用性。

    3. 响应式数据:Vue 2.x使用了双向绑定的数据流,当数据变化时,视图会自动更新。

    4. 虚拟DOM:Vue 2.x使用虚拟DOM技术,可以高效地进行DOM操作和更新。

    5. 插件系统:Vue 2.x提供了丰富的插件系统,可以扩展Vue的功能。

    使用方法:

    1. 引入Vue.js:在HTML文件中引入Vue.js的CDN链接或下载Vue.js文件并引入。

    2. 创建Vue实例:通过调用Vue构造函数,创建一个Vue实例。

    3. 编写模板:使用Vue提供的模板语法编写页面模板。

    4. 定义数据和方法:在Vue实例中,定义需要响应式的数据和方法。

    5. 绑定数据和视图:通过在模板中使用插值表达式或指令,将数据和视图进行绑定。

    6. 响应用户交互:在模板中使用指令或事件监听器,响应用户的交互动作。

    7. 使用组件:将页面划分为多个组件,并在Vue实例中注册和使用这些组件。

    8. 运行Vue应用:将Vue实例挂载到指定的DOM元素上,以运行Vue应用。

    Vue 3.x版本

    Vue 3.x是最新发布的版本,带来了许多改进和新特性。以下是Vue 3.x版本的一些特点和使用方法:

    特点:

    1. 更好的性能:Vue 3.x通过优化底层机制,提升了性能和加载速度。

    2. 更小的体积:Vue 3.x对打包体积进行了优化,代码体积更小。

    3. Composition API:Vue 3.x引入了Composition API,提供了更灵活和可复用的逻辑组合方式。

    4. 更好的TypeScript支持:Vue 3.x对TypeScript的支持更为完善。

    5. 改进的响应式系统:Vue 3.x对响应式系统进行了改进,减少了重渲染次数。

    使用方法:

    1. 安装Vue 3.x:通过npm或yarn安装Vue 3.x的最新版本。

    2. 引入Vue:在JavaScript文件中引入Vue模块。

    3. 创建App实例:调用createApp函数创建一个Vue实例。

    4. 编写组件:使用Vue提供的组件语法编写页面组件。

    5. 定义逻辑:使用Composition API编写组件的逻辑。

    6. 运行Vue应用:调用mount函数将Vue应用挂载到DOM元素上,以启动应用。

    需要注意的是,由于Vue 3.x引入了一些新的特性,与Vue 2.x存在一些兼容性差异。所以,在升级到Vue 3.x时,需要进行一些改动和调整。同时,也要根据项目的实际情况和需求选择适合的版本。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部